Is Brandonville a Good Place to Live?
Economy & Jobs
Brandonville residents earn a median household income of $87,083 , which is 16% above the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$37,808. The unemployment rate stands at 5.5% (53% above the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 5.3%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 884 business establishments, including 31 restaurants.
Housing & Cost of Living
The median home value in Brandonville is $183,300 , 35%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$100,465. The cost of living index is 89.5 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1985.
Safety & Crime
Brandonville reports 34 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 91%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 0/100K.
Education
32.6% of adults in Brandonville hold a bachelor's degree or higher (3% below the national average). 93.3% have completed high school. Local schools score 4.5/10 in standardized testing.
Climate & Weather
Brandonville has an average annual temperature of 47°F (8°C). Winters average 25°F in January while summers reach 67°F in July. The area gets 290 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 55.7 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 39.
